Dr. Ray Crum is a leading figure in space power systems, with a focused expertise in deployable infrastructure for extreme extraterrestrial environments. His most notable contribution is the development of the Lunar Array, Mast, and Power System (LAMPS), a groundbreaking vertical solar array designed to provide reliable power at the lunar poles. This work, published in 2023, represents a critical advancement for sustained lunar exploration, addressing the unique challenges of low-angle sunlight and harsh terrain. As a key collaborator between Honeybee Robotics and mPower Technology, Dr. Crum’s research directly enables future Artemis missions and long-term habitation on the Moon.
